Step-by-step explanation:
To calculate the infusion rate in drops per minute (gtt/min) for a volume of 80 mLs infused over 1 hour and 20 minutes using a microdrip set, you need to know the drop factor of the microdrip set. Microdrip sets typically have a drop factor of 60 gtt/mL. First, convert the time to minutes: 1 hour is 60 minutes, and 20 minutes is 20 minutes, so the total time is 80 minutes.
Next, calculate the rate using the following formula:
Infusion rate (gtt/min) = (Volume in mLs × Drop factor) / Time in minutes
Infusion rate (gtt/min) = (80 mLs × 60 gtt/mL) / 80 minutes
Infusion rate (gtt/min) = 4800 gtt / 80 minutes
Infusion rate (gtt/min) = 60 gtt/min.
Therefore, the infusion would need to be set at 60 drops per minute to deliver 80 mLs over the course of 1 hour and 20 minutes.
